Part Overview
The MAX3243IPW is a 3/5 Transceiver Full RS232 interface IC in 28-TSSOP surface mount packaging, manufactured by Texas Instruments. This part is classified as Obsolete, making equivalent and substitute parts necessary for new designs and ongoing production requirements. The MAX3243IPW operates across 3V to 5.5V supply voltage with full-duplex RS232 communication capability, supporting data rates up to 250kbps with 500mV receiver hysteresis.

Substitute Part Grouping Explanation
Substitution for the MAX3243IPW is determined by the following critical parameters: RS232 protocol compliance, 3/5 driver/receiver configuration, full-duplex operation, 28-pin surface mount packaging (TSSOP or SSOP variants), voltage supply range of 3V to 5.5V, and data rate capability of 250kbps or higher. The receiver hysteresis specification of 500mV is a key electrical parameter for signal integrity.
Substitute parts are grouped into two categories:
Category 1: Direct Equivalents (Active Status) Parts maintaining identical electrical specifications and 28-TSSOP packaging with -40°C to 85°C operating temperature range, ensuring drop-in replacement capability.
Category 2: Functional Equivalents (Active Status) Parts with compatible RS232 3/5 transceiver functionality in 28-pin packaging but with alternative package variants (28-SSOP) or modified operating temperature ranges (0°C to 70°C), requiring design verification for thermal and mechanical compatibility.

Engineering Selection Recommendations
Primary Recommendation: MAX3243IPWR
The MAX3243IPWR is the direct active equivalent to the MAX3243IPW. Manufactured by Texas Instruments, it maintains identical electrical specifications including 250kbps data rate, 500mV receiver hysteresis, and -40°C to 85°C operating temperature range. The part is in Active product status with unlimited moisture sensitivity rating (MSL 1), ensuring long-term availability and supply chain stability. This part requires no design modifications and provides the highest compatibility for direct replacement applications.
Secondary Recommendation: ICL3243EIVZ-T
The ICL3243EIVZ-T, manufactured by Renesas Electronics Corporation, provides functional equivalence with identical electrical performance and 28-TSSOP packaging. It maintains the -40°C to 85°C operating temperature range and 250kbps data rate. The part is in Active status with ROHS3 compliance. The MSL 3 rating (168 hours) requires standard moisture control during storage and assembly.
Alternative for Extended Temperature Range: ICL3243EIAZ-T
For applications requiring 28-SSOP packaging instead of 28-TSSOP, the ICL3243EIAZ-T offers identical electrical specifications with -40°C to 85°C operating temperature coverage. The 28-SSOP package (0.209", 5.30mm width) differs mechanically from the original 28-TSSOP (0.173", 4.40mm width), requiring PCB layout verification. MSL 2 rating (1 year) applies.
Not Recommended: MAX3243CUI+ and MAX3243CUI+T
These parts exhibit reduced data rate (120Kbps versus 250kbps) and lower receiver hysteresis (300mV versus 500mV), making them unsuitable for applications requiring the full electrical performance of the MAX3243IPW.
Frequently Asked Questions (FAQ)
Q: Can MAX3243IPWR be used as a direct replacement for MAX3243IPW?
A: Yes. The MAX3243IPWR is the active equivalent part from Texas Instruments with identical electrical specifications, package type (28-TSSOP), and operating temperature range (-40°C to 85°C). No design changes are required.
Q: What is the difference between 28-TSSOP and 28-SSOP packaging?
A: Both are 28-pin surface mount packages but differ in physical dimensions. The 28-TSSOP has a width of 0.173" (4.40mm), while the 28-SSOP has a width of 0.209" (5.30mm). PCB footprints are not interchangeable; layout verification is required when switching between these package types.
Q: Are Renesas ICL3243 parts compatible with the MAX3243IPW?
A: Renesas ICL3243 parts maintain RS232 3/5 transceiver functionality with identical data rates (250kbps) and voltage supply ranges (3V to 5.5V). Parts with -40°C to 85°C operating temperature (ICL3243EIVZ-T, ICL3243EIAZ, ICL3243EIAZ-T) provide full electrical compatibility. Parts with 0°C to 70°C operating temperature require thermal environment verification. Package variants (TSSOP versus SSOP) require PCB layout confirmation.
Q: What does MSL rating mean for component selection?
A: MSL (Moisture Sensitivity Level) indicates the maximum time a component can be exposed to ambient conditions before soldering. MSL 1 (Unlimited) allows indefinite storage without moisture control. MSL 2 (1 Year) and MSL 3 (168 Hours) require controlled storage environments and baking procedures before assembly. The MAX3243IPW has MSL 1; substitute parts with higher MSL ratings require additional moisture management during manufacturing.
Q: Why is the MAX3243IPW classified as Obsolete?
A: Obsolete status indicates Texas Instruments has discontinued this specific part number. The MAX3243IPWR is the active replacement, maintaining full compatibility while ensuring continued availability and manufacturing support.
Q: Can MAX3243CUI+ be used instead of MAX3243IPW?
A: No. The MAX3243CUI+ operates at reduced data rate (120Kbps versus 250kbps) and lower receiver hysteresis (300mV versus 500mV). These electrical differences make it unsuitable for applications requiring the full performance specifications of the MAX3243IPW.
